Common Wood Window Service Jobs
Wood window repair - restoring damaged or rotted wood to extend window lifespan.
Wood window replacement - installing new wood frames to improve energy efficiency and appearance.
Wood window restoration - refinishing and refurbishing historic or antique wood windows.
Wood window maintenance - cleaning, sealing, and protecting wood surfaces to prevent deterioration.
Wood window glazing - replacing or repairing window panes and sealing to improve insulation.
Wood window custom work - creating tailored wood frames to match existing architectural styles.
Wood Window Service Questions
What types of wood window services are available? Services include repair, restoration, replacement, and maintenance of wood windows to improve appearance and functionality.
Can wood windows be restored instead of replaced? Yes, many wood window issues can be addressed through restoration, preserving the original character and saving costs.
What should property owners know about wood window upkeep? Regular inspections and proper sealing help maintain wood windows and prevent damage from moisture and pests.
Are custom wood window projects possible? Customization options are available for sizes, styles, and finishes to match existing architecture and personal preferences.
